About This Item

1835. Single Sheet. A bank draft on the Mechanics' & Farmers' Bank dated Feb. 9, 1835 in the amount of $75.21 for "Tolls Refunded" to Simon M. Holden. Signed by John A. Dix. Dix was a Governor of New York, US Senator, Secretary of the Treasury, and future Civil War General. Azariah C. Flagg. Drawn on the Canal Fund, this document is signed by four Commissioners of the Canal Fund--Dix, Flagg, Abraham Keyser, and William Campbell. Two small internal circular closed tears, (not especially objectionable). The verso of the document has written: "Chemung Canal" Could this be the same Simon M. Holden who was murdered in Washtenaw County, Michigan during a robbery where $500 was stolen from him? ; 5" x 6.25"; Signed by All Authors .
